Four arrested in Jenkins County drug bust, guns and cash seized

JENKINS COUNTY, Ga () – Four people in Jenkins County have been arrested after multiple search warrants were issued where drugs, drug paraphernalia and guns were seized. 

On August 22nd, the Effingham County Sheriff’s Office Drug Suppression Unit, along with the Jenkins County Sheriff’s Office, Bryan County Sheriff’s Office K-9 Unit and the Rincon Police Department K-9 Unit, conducted two search warrants at the Sunset Inn on US-25 in Millen and one at a home in the 700 block of Old Waynesboro Road in Millen.

Jenkins County Sheriff Robert Oglesby deputized ECSO investigators to assist with the investigation.

During the warrant searches, investigators found several guns, Methamphetamine, crack cocaine, cocaine, marijuana, multiple controlled substances, tools for distributing controlled substances and thousands of dollars in cash.

Marquette Wadley was arrested at the home on Old Waynesboro Road and charged with possession of cocaine, crack cocaine and marijuana with the intent to distribute. 

Shavelle Lovette and Karen Summers were arrested at the Sunsett Inn and charged with possession of methamphetamine, psilocybin, and other controlled substances with the intent to distribute, possession of the tools for the commission of a felony, use of a communication device to facilitate a felony and possession of a firearm by a convicted felon. 

Artravious Adams was also arrested at the Sunsett Inn and charged with possession of methamphetamine with the intent to distribute and possession of tools for the commission of a felony.
